Ingredients: The Key to Deliciousness

Gathering the right ingredients is the first step to baking a perfect loaf of apple cinnamon bread.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• All-Purpose Flour: 3 cups (360g), plus more for dusting
  • Granulated Sugar: 1 cup (200g)
  • Brown Sugar: 1/2 cup (100g), packed
  • Baking Powder: 1 teaspoon
  • Baking Soda: 1/2 teaspoon
  • Salt: 1/2 teaspoon
  • Ground Cinnamon: 2 teaspoons, plus more for swirling
  • Ground Nutmeg: 1/4 teaspoon (optional, for added warmth)
  • Eggs: 2 large
  • Vegetable Oil: 1/2 cup (120ml), or melted coconut oil
  • Applesauce: 1/2 cup (120ml), unsweetened
  • Vanilla Extract: 1 teaspoon
  • Milk or Buttermilk: 1/4 cup (60ml)
  • Apples: 2 cups (about 2 medium), peeled, cored, and diced. Granny Smith, Honeycrisp, or Fuji varieties work well.

Step-by-Step Instructions: Baking Made Easy

Follow these simple steps to create your own delicious apple cinnamon bread:

  1. Preheat and Prep: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9×5 inch loaf pan. Alternatively, line the pan with parchment paper, leaving an overhang for easy removal.
  2. Combine Dry Ingredients: In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, granulated sugar, brown sugar, baking powder,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, and nutmeg (if using).
  3. Combine Wet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s, vegetable oil, applesauce, and vanilla extract. Gradually add the milk or buttermilk until well combined.
  4. Combine Wet and Dry: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and mix until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; a few lumps are okay.
  5. Fold in Apples: Gently fold in the diced apples until evenly distributed throughout the batter.
  6. Create the Cinnamon Swirl: In a small bowl, mix together 2 tablespoons of granulated sugar and 1 teaspoon of ground cinnamon.
  7. Layer and Swirl: Pour half of the batter into the prepared loaf pan. Sprinkle half of the cinnamon-sugar mixture over the batter. Pour the remaining batter over the cinnamon-sugar layer, and sprinkle the remaining cinnamon-sugar mixture on top. Use a knife or skewer to gently swirl the cinnamon sugar into the batter.
  8. Bake: Bake for 50-60 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ean. If the top of the bread is browning too quickly, tent it loosely with aluminum foil.
  9. Cool and Slice: Let the bread cool in the pan for 10 minutes before transferring it to a wire rack to cool completely. Slice and enjoy!

Tips for the Perfect Loaf

  • Don’t Overmix: Overmixing the batter develops the gluten in the flour, resulting in a tough bread. Mix until just combined.
  • Use Room Temperature Ingredients: Using room temperature ingredients helps them to combine more easily, creating a smoother batter.
  • Don’t Overbake: Overbaking will result in a dry bread. Check for doneness using a wooden skewer.
  • Add Nuts (Optional): For added flavor and texture, add 1/2 cup of chopped walnuts or pecans to the batter.
  • Glaze It: Drizzle a simple powdered sugar glaze over the cooled bread for extra sweetness.

Variations to Spice Things Up

  • Cranberry Apple Cinnamon Bread: Add 1/2 cup of dried cranberries for a festive twist.
  • Caramel Apple Cinnamon Bread: Drizzle caramel sauce over the top of the bread before baking.
  • Apple Cinnamon Streusel Bread: Top the bread with a streusel topping made from flour, butter, sugar, and cinnamon.

FAQs: Your Questions Answered

Can I use different types of apples?

Yes, absolutely! Granny Smith apples are a classic choice for baking due to their tartness, which balances the sweetness of the bread. However, you can also use other varieties like Honeycrisp, Fuji, or Gala. A combination of different apples can add depth and complexity to the flavor.

How do I prevent the bread from being too dry?

Several factors can contribute to dry bread. First, avoid overbaking. Check for doneness using a wooden skewer, and remove the bread from the oven as soon as the skewer comes out clean. Second, ensure accurate measurements of ingredients, especially flour. Too much flour can lead to a dry texture. Finally, storing the bread properly in an airtight container will help retain moisture.

Can I freeze apple cinnamon bread?

Yes, apple cinnamon bread freezes well. Allow the bread to cool completely before wrapping it tightly in plastic wrap, followed by a layer of aluminum foil, or placing it in a freezer-safe bag. It can be stored in the freezer for up to 2-3 months. Thaw it overnight in the refrigerator or at room temperature before slicing and serving.

Can I make this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, you can adapt this recipe to be gluten-free by using a gluten-free all-purpose flour blend. Ensure the blend contains xanthan gum or add it separately, as it acts as a binding agent in the absence of gluten. The baking time may need to be adjusted slightly, so keep a close eye on the bread as it bakes.

How do I store apple cinnamon bread?

To keep your apple cinnamon bread fresh, store it in an airtight container at room temperature. It will typically stay moist for 2-3 days. For longer storage, you can refrigerate it, but be aware that refrigeration may slightly dry out the bread. If refrigerating, wrap the bread well to prevent it from absorbing odors from the refrigerator.
